Rajamala Wildlife Sanctuary, one of the
leading tourist attractions in Kerala, is
located 15 kms away from Munnar. Rajamala
Wildlife Sanctuary is really the natural
habitat of the Nilgiri Tahr. Rajamala Wildlife
Sanctuary houses half the world’s
population of this rare mountain goat. The
Rajamala Wildlife Sanctuary is an attempt
to preserve this rare species of the goat
family, which is fast approaching extinction.
Rajamala Wildlife Sanctuary
is a part of the Eravikulam Wildlife Sanctuary.
Visitors are only allowed to go inside the
tourism area in the Rajamala region. This
method is adopted in order to restore harmony
and sanctify the natural habitat that facilitates
the process of conservation of these wild
animals. The total number of Nilgiri Tahrs
in Rajamala is estimated to be 1317.
